How much does it cost to rent an apartment in City Center?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| City Center Studio Apartments | $1,068 | $800 | $1,499 |
City Center 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,426 | $890 | $1,896 |
| City Center 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,762 | $899 | $3,120 |
| City Center 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,106 | $709 | $1,900 |
| City Center 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,365 | $649 | $2,400 |

Getting Around the City Center Neighborhood in Chattanooga, TN
Walk Score®
86 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
94 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
47 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
